Abstract

The concentrations of iron, manganese, zinc, copper, lead, cobalt, cadmium, nickel and chromium in soil samples from Yahyali-Kayseri, Turkey were determined by flame atomic absorption spectrometry (FAAS) after digestion aqua regia. The ranges for the analytes in the soil samples were found as 11.1-15.2 mg/g for iron, 0.6-1.1 mg/g for manganese, 0.1-0.69 mg/g for zinc, 59.3-124.1 ug/g for lead, 39.8-282 ug/g for nickel, 41.2-79 ug/g for chromium, 39.6-156.5 μg/g for copper, 14.3-24.4 μg/g for cobalt, 5.9-10.5 μg/g for cadmium. The correctness of the procedure was checked with analysis certified reference materials and with addition-recovery tests to different soil samoles.
